How does a phlebotomy insurance specialist typically collaborate with clinical staff and insurance companies in their daily work?

A Phlebotomy Insurance Specialist serves as a critical link between clinical teams, patients, and insurance providers. On a typical day, they verify patients’ insurance eligibility, ensure proper documentation for lab tests, and resolve billing discrepancies by communicating with both healthcare providers and insurers. Effective collaboration with clinical staff is essential to obtain accurate patient information and clarify test orders, while regular contact with insurance companies helps address claim denials and expedite reimbursements. This role requires strong commun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to navigate complex insurance processes.

What is phlebotomy insurance?

Phlebotomy insurance is a type of professional liability insurance designed specifically for phlebotomists. It provides coverage in case of claims or lawsuits arising from errors, accidents, or negligence that may occur while drawing blood or handling patients. This insurance helps protect phlebotomists from financial losses related to legal fees, settlements, or damages, ensuring they can perform their duties with peace of mind. Many employers require phlebotomists to have this coverage, especially if they work as independent contractors or in multiple healthcare settings.

Job description

Who We Are
We're building a better way to donate plasma - one that's fast, friendly, and powered by smart technology - our donor app makes booking and earning easy for donors, and our team makes every visit feel welcoming and personal. We've grown from 2 to 30+ locations in under 3 years, and we're just getting started. If you want to grow your career with a high-energy team, this is a great opportunity.
What You'll Do
As a Phlebotomist, you will be a key member of the site's lean team, and a critical part of the donor experience. You will be responsible for performing venipuncture for plasmapheresis and supporting our fast-paced daily operations, working collaboratively with center staff to create a positive environment for the team and our donors. You will have a unique opportunity to be part of a high-growth organization, one that is changing rapidly and creating new opportunities for our high-performing team members.
  • Own donor floor activities: setup, phlebotomy, disconnect, and documentation
  • Set up donor stations and ensure equipment is calibrated and ready
  • Create a welcoming environment for donors by guiding them through the process
  • Work collaboratively with all center staff
  • Have an opportunity to gain new responsibilities with the potential to earn more! 

  • At least 18 years old
  • High school diploma, GED equivalent, or higher education
  • Able to lift 50 pounds and stand or sit for extended periods
  • Able to work weekends, regularly or as needed
  • 2+ years of experience in phlebotomy, medical field, or customer service
  • Competitive pay + monthly bonus potential
  • Significant career growth opportunities in a fast-scaling environment
  • Medical, dental, and vision insurance
  • Paid time off and company holidays
